A couple of things that others have tried ...they didn't work for me but they did for them are...while viewing NW Connections/properties, uncheck Enable network access control using IEEE 802.1X, in the authentication tab..supposedly XP can't use that authentication...In the Wireless Networks tab, uncheck Use Windows to configure my wireless connection. When I did that, I couldn't hardly keep a connection, but for other people, it helped. It's a place to start...
